Tree-removal operations in urban and suburban settings often employ extensive use of rope-based rigging to control and manage the dismantling of large trees. These scenarios typically conclude in what is commonly referred to as a negative-rigging situation, where the load the rigging must bear “falls into the rope” from above the anchor point (such as when we work our way down a spar). This results in dynamic forces being placed on the tree and equipment that far exceed the static load of the massof the cut log. Any opportunity to mitigate these forces while still working efficiently is a bonus for us - the working arborists - and our equipment.
